bitstamp-cli

A command line interface application to talk with Bitstamp

How to install

npm install -g bitstamp-cli

Available commands

Ticker

Returns data for the specified currency pair. Currently supported pairs are: btc/usd, btc/eur, eur/usd, xrp/usd, xrp/eur, xrp/btc, ltc/usd, ltc/eur, ltc/btc, eth/usd, eth/eur, eth/btc, bch/usd, bch/eur, bch/btc.

Example

$ bitstamp ticker btc usd
Last price                                  13452.00       
Last 24 hours price high                    15599.64       
Last 24 hours price low                     12488.00       
Last 24 hours volume weighted average price 14001.13       
Last 24 hours volume                        20012.96389619 
Highest buy order                           13455.97       
Lowest sell order                           13485.00       
Unix timestamp date and time                1514132372     
First price of the day                      14619.00

Conversion

Returns the EUR/USD conversion rate.

Example

$ bitstamp conversion
Buy  1.1900 
Sell 1.1803

Setup

Setup private access to Bitstamp using your username and an API key you created on Bitstamp.

Example

$ bitstamp setup abc123 a1z2e3r4t5y6u7i8o9p0
? Enter your API secret: [input is hidden]

Balance

Returns the current account balance.

Example

$ bitstamp balance
    Balance    Available  Reserved   
USD 0.00       0.00       0.00       
EUR 0.00       0.00       0.00       
BTC 0.11111111 0.11111111 0.11111111 
XRP 0.22222222 0.22222222 0.22222222 
LTC 0.33333333 0.33333333 0.33333333 
ETH 0.44444444 0.44444444 0.44444444 
BCH 0.55555555 0.55555555 0.55555555

My transactions

Returns the current account transactions.

Example

$ bitstamp mytransactions
Type         Date and time       Amount           Value       Rate         Fee      
Market trade 2017-12-12 12:12:12 123.12345678 XRP -473.81 EUR 0.81276 EUR  1.19 EUR 
None         2017-12-22 12:12:12 500.00 USD                                0.00 USD

Warning

I don't have enough data on my account to test the transactions endpoint response parsing. This command could crash with yours. Feel free to create an issue.
